Capability checking for thread_control, exregs, mutex, cap_control,
ipc, and map system calls.
The visualised model is implemented in code that compiles, but
actual functionality hasn't been tested.
Need to add:
- Dynamic assignment of initial resources matching with what's
defined in the configuration.
- A paged-thread-group, since that would be a logical group of
seperation from a capability point-of-view.
- Resource ids for various tasks. E.g.
- Memory capabilities don't have target resources.
- Thread capability assumes current container for THREAD_CREATE.
- Mutex syscall assumes current thread (this one may not need
any changing)
- cap_control syscall assumes current thread. It may happen to
be that another thread's capability list is manipulated.
Last but not least:
- A simple and easy-to-use userspace library for dynamic expansion
of resource domains as new resources are created such as threads.
